Enjoy an Environmentally Friendly Lifestyle at the Crossings of Chino Hills

Did you know that the US is the #1 trash-producing country in the world at 1,609 pounds per person per year ? This means that 5 percent of the world’s population generates 40 percent of the world’s waste. This data, along with countless other studies, makes it clear that there is a need to be more friendly to our environment.

At The Crossings of Chino Hills , we want to do all we can to protect the environment and promote a sustainable lifestyle. We are taking action by eliminating water waste, reducing paper and plastic waste, and encouraging recycling.

We Are Preserving Water

Since Chino Hills is an area prone to droughts, we are careful not to waste water on our property. To do this, we use drought-tolerant plants in our landscaping. These plants use much less water than other plants that are commonly used. We have also placed beautiful stone where some grass and mulch areas might be considered. Where watering is needed, our drip irrigation system is designed to significantly reduce the amount of water used.

Next, we save on water indoors with our low-flow toilets . Most toilets use 3.5 gallons of water with each flush, but the toilets at Chino Hills use about 20 percent less. Each low-flow toilet saves up to an impressive 13,000 gallons of water per year.

We Are Encouraging Recycling

One of the best ways to live a sustainable lifestyle is to recycle. We have recycling bins in our office, and we encourage all residents to recycle as well. Items you can recycle include plastic bottles and containers, empty cans, paper, and flattened cardboard. However, you cannot recycle food, liquid, plastic bags, plastic wrap, or cups with wax or plastic coating.
